Congressman Rohrabacher admits disappointment in farewell

California Congressman Dana Rohrabacher says in his farewell to the House that looking back he was disappointed that government did not achieve all that was possible but Republicans and Democrats can be proud of accomplishments nationally and back home and meeting the needs of citizens to make America a better place not from the top down vote from the bottom up.
